"No Java installation could be found. Please check your installation!"

However, I can't find this string (even allowing for placeholders) in
DEV300_m14 or DEV300_m17.

Does anyone know where to find this string?

That seems to originate from the database's JDBC driver in
connectivity/source/drivers/jdbc/JConnection.cxx, used as an SQL
exception message that then is displayed later.

There is actually quite an amount of SQLException messages that are
hard-wired to English. There may be a reason for that, e.g. other layers
expecting it. Please check back with the Base team for details.

Is it translated in builds in any other language?

Most certainly not.


OK, I reported this as issue 90616 [1], and the response supported my assertion that these messages should be translated. So, hopefully we will see them in the GSI file (or appropriate translation mechanism) soon.
